Adriano Tomaso Banchieri (Bologna, 3 September 1568 – Bologna, 1634) was an Italian composer, music theorist, organist, writer on music, and poet of the late Renaissance and early Baroque eras. He founded the Accademia dei Floridi in Bologna.

L’Alcenagina, sopra Vestiva i colli was first published in 1596 in Canzoni alla francese a quattro voci per sonare (No.6).
